首页
学习
活动
专区
工具
TVP
发布

学习力

专栏作者
39
文章
21527
阅读量
22
订阅数
《Java从入门到放弃》框架入门篇:springMVC基本用法
springMVC可以理解成用来做数据显示处理的框架,主要内容就是控制器和视图的处理。
十方上下
2019-03-14
3150
《Java从入门到放弃》框架入门篇:springMVC数据校验
昨天我们扯完了数据传递,今天我们来聊聊数据校验的问题。来,跟着我一起读:计一噢叫,一按艳。 在springMVC中校验数据也非常简单,spring3.0拥有自己独立的数据校验框架,同时支持JSR303标准的校验框架。 Spring的DataBinder在进行数据绑定时,会同时调用校验框架完成数据校验工作。 具体使用步骤如下: 1)导入数据校验的JAR包 2)在springmvc的配置文件中添加校验Bean 3)修改实体类,在属性上加上校验的注解 4)修改昨天的login4方法,加上校验的相关代码
十方上下
2018-06-14
5410
《Java从入门到放弃》框架入门篇:springMVC数据传递 (二)
上一篇讲完了springMVC中数据传递中的接收数据,今天继续完成数据的向后传递。 数据传递的核心对象ModelAndView,注意其包名,不要引用错了! 正确的:org.springframework.web.servlet.ModelAndView 错误的:org.springframework.web.portlet.ModelAndView 我们继续完成前面的登录功能: 如果登录成功则跳转到index.jsp,并显示“欢迎你:xxxx(用户的昵称)”。 如果登录失败则回到login.jsp,并显示
十方上下
2018-06-14
8340
《Java从入门到放弃》框架入门篇:springMVC数据传递
springMVC中的数据传递方式与JSP和Struts2相比,更加的简单。具体有什么样的区别呢?我们通过下面这张图来对比就知道了。 随手画的,有些错别字,不用太在意..... 接下来,进入正题,sp
十方上下
2018-06-14
9820
《Java从入门到放弃》框架入门篇:springMVC基本用法
springMVC可以理解成用来做数据显示处理的框架,主要内容就是控制器和视图的处理。 在已经安装了spring框架的基础上继续下面的步骤(我使用的MyEclipse2014)。     1. 修改web.xml文件     2. 在WEB-INF目录创建springmvc的配置文件     3. 新建一个用来放控制器的包     4. 在包中创建控制器类     5. 访问对应地址 不废话,直接干!!! 一、修改web.xml文件     <servlet>         <servlet-
十方上下
2018-06-14
3940
《Java从入门到放弃》框架入门篇:spring中AOP的配置方式
spring中最核心的两个东东,一个IOC,一个AOP。 AOP(Aspect-OrientedProgramming)面向方面编程,也可以叫面向切面编程。 从一个新人的角度可以这样来理解:一般软件中的功能,我们可以分为两大类,一类是业务功能,一类是系统功能。 业务功能是指这个软件必须要用到的,没有的话客户就不给钱的。比如淘宝APP,如果你只能在上面浏览商品而不能购物,那就说明业务功能太监了···。 系统功能主要是指与业务无关,没有这块内容也不影响软件使用的。比如日志管理、权限处理等。 AOP主要用来做什
十方上下
2018-06-14
6700
《Java从入门到放弃》框架入门篇:spring中IOC的注入姿势
IOC到底是个什么东东呢?控制反转(Inversion of Control,英文缩写为IoC),其实就是这个东东。 你随便百度一下就会得到比较书面的解释:通过引入实现了IoC模式的IoC容器,即可由IoC容器来管理对象的生命周期、依赖关系等,从而使得应用程序的配置和依赖性规范与实际的应用程序代码分开。其中一个特点就是通过文本的配置文件进行应用程序组件间相互关系的配置,而不用重新修改并编译具体的代码。 说了这么多,通过一个例子就能很好的来理解。以前小王要找对象,要么云茫茫人海中进行匹配(通过 小王.对象=小
十方上下
2018-06-14
4400
没有更多了
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档